## v4.8.2

- Template rendering: cached compiled templates per worker; p95 render time down ~40%.
- Fixed cache stampede on cold restarts.
- Rollback: revert flag `tpl_cache_v2`.

On-call: if render latency alerts fire after deploy, disable the flag first, then page the owner. Owner for this change is:

named custodian: Brivan Eliath Quenox Frador

**Vendor note: Inkmill markdown pipeline**

Rendering for Parchway docs is outsourced to Inkmill under an annual contract, renewing each March. They handle sanitization and PDF export; we own the upload queue. SLA: 4-hour response on rendering failures. Escalate only after two failed retries. Their support desk is reachable at the address below.

billing contact of hahaf-baguf = zorael.tammir.jorius@sivrelhq.internal

## Runbook: Slow template renders (Fernwick)

Check cache hit rate first. Below 80%, the render cache is likely cold or evicting. Restart one worker, watch latency. If unchanged, precompile via `fern precompile --all`. The precompiler needs write access to the shared cache; set its credential on the next line of the env file.

sealed setting: VAULT_KEY20=69e2a0b23f1a79fbf692